Función MagSetWindowFilterList (magnification.h)

Establece la lista de ventanas que se van a ampliar o la lista de ventanas que se excluirán de la ampliación.

Sintaxis

BOOL MagSetWindowFilterList(
  [in] HWND  hwnd,
  [in] DWORD dwFilterMode,
  [in] int   count,
  [in] HWND  *pHWND
);

Parámetros

[in] hwnd

Tipo: HWND

Identificador de la ventana de ampliación.

[in] dwFilterMode

Tipo: DWORD

Modo de filtro de ampliación. Puede ser uno de los siguientes valores:

Valor Significado
MW_FILTERMODE_INCLUDE Magnify las ventanas.
Nota: Este valor no se admite en Windows 7 o versiones posteriores.
 
MW_FILTERMODE_EXCLUDE Excluya las ventanas de ampliación.

[in] count

Tipo: int

Número de identificadores de ventana en la lista.

[in] pHWND

Tipo: HWND*

Lista de identificadores de ventana.

Valor devuelto

Tipo: BOOL

Devuelve TRUE si es correcto o FALSE en caso contrario.

Comentarios

Esta función requiere tarjetas de vídeo compatibles con windows Display Driver Model (WDDM).

Solo se usa una lista de ventanas. Puede especificar MW_FILTERMODE_INCLUDE o MW_FILTERMODE_EXCLUDE, dependiendo de si es más conveniente enumerar ventanas incluidas o ventanas excluidas.

La ventana de ampliación se excluye automáticamente.

Requisitos

   
Cliente mínimo compatible Windows Vista [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ows Server 2008 [solo aplicaciones de escritorio]
Plataforma de destino Windows
Encabezado magnification.h
Library Magnification.lib
Archivo DLL Magnification.dll

Consulte también

MagGetWindowFilterList